Here is a short video compilation from the ceremony.
Irish bagpipes played during the unveiling.
Exactly 100 years ago, during a 1910 interview with Tim Murnane, O'Rourke stated that:
"Baseball is for all creeds and nationalities".
This quote is prominently displayed on the statue's base.
